Intended as a basic, practical manual for building all plank-on-frame models, this book takes as its example the Royal Navy's two-masted sloop, "Cruiser" of 1752. It leads the reader through every stage of building a model from preliminary research, through taking off lines, to the construction of the model and eventual display. Photographs of the author's model, taken during its building and explanatory line drawnigs are used extensively to describe each stage of the process.

The late Ron McCarthy had been a professional modelmaker since leaving school at the age of 14. His first job during the Second World War was building 100ft-to-the-inch Admirally recognition vessels. He was also a member of the team which built the model of the Mulberry Harbour. After the war he worked for a number of years building shipbuilders' models. He built many sailing ship models and was a regular contributor to the journal Model Shipwright.
